Final Fantasy XI players sue Square Enix

Final Fantasy XI, the only online game in the popular RPG series, certainly has a few rough spots. A group of players apparently had enough with the mischievous actions of Square Enix and is suing the said company. 

The class action lawsuit against Square Enix alleges that the publisher and developer of Final Fantasy XI used “deceptive advertising, unfair practices, and fraudulent concealment to conceal certain critical information about their online games.” Among the complaints include extraneous charges and unfair account terminations.
